The Sensor Cook feature makes cooking your favorite
foods easy. By actually sensing the steam that escapes
as food cooks, this feature automatically adjusts the
oven’s cooking time to various types and amounts
of food.

Because most cooking containers must be covered
during Sensor Cook, this feature is best with foods
that you want to steam or retain moisture.

NOTE: Do NOT use the metal shelf with
Sensor Reheat.

NOTE: Do not use this feature twice in
succession on the same food portion—it may
result in severely overcooked or burnt food.

SENSOR COOK

Foods Recommended

Foods Not Recommended

A wide variety
of foods including
meats, fish and
vegetables can be
cooked using this
feature.

Foods that must be
cooked uncovered,
foods that require
constant attention,
foods that require
addition of ingredients
during cooking and
foods calling for a dry
look or crisp surface after cooking should not be cooked
using this feature. It is best to Micro Cook them.

Foods that microwave best using the temperature probe
should be Temp Cooked or Combination Roasted.

Easy to Use

Keep Door Closed

Simply touch 3 control pads—SENSOR COOK,
desired CODE, and START. The word ‘‘AUTO’’
appears on the display and the sensor is activated to
sense steam from food.

If food is undercooked after the countdown use
MICRO COOK for additional cooking time.

Do not open the oven door while the word ‘‘AUTO’’
is displayed—steam escaping from the oven can
affect cooking performance. If the door is opened,
close the door and touch START immediately.

Sensor Cook Codes

Sensor Cook codes 1 through 7 are designed to give you easy, automatic
results with a number of popular foods. See the Sensor Cooking Control
Guide section for specific foods and instructions.

Example:

Step 1: Place covered food in oven. Touch SENSOR
COOK pad. ‘‘ENTER FOOD CODE’’ flashes on
display.

Step 2: Touch number pad of desired food code. The
code and food type you selected will appear on the
display. “FOOD” and “CODE” flash. After 4 seconds,
“START” flashes on the display. Touch START.

Word ‘‘AUTO’’ shows
on display, indicating
steam sensor is activated.
DO NOT OPEN DOOR.
OPENING DOOR MAY
AFFECT COOKING
PERFORMANCE.

Beep sounds when steam
is sensed and ‘‘AUTO’’
is replaced by cook time.
Rotate or stir food, if
necessary. When done,
oven beeps every minute
until door is opened or
CLEAR/OFF is touched.
